Optically-controlled extinction ratio and Q-factor tunable silicon microring resonators based on optical forces

We present optically-controlled extinction ratio (ER) and Q-factor tunable silicon microring resonators using optical forces. Two opto-mechanical structures are studied, i.e. double-clamped and cantilever. A wide ER tuning range from 5.6 to 34.2dB is achieved. Low control power of 1.4mW is required for cantilever structure.
机译:我们介绍利用光力的光控消光比(ER)和Q因子可调谐硅微环谐振器。研究了两种光机械结构,即双夹和悬臂式。可以实现从5.6到34.2dB的宽ER调谐范围。悬臂结构需要1.4mW的低控制功率。
